Thanks Paulo, I've actually worked it out.

I should have used:

pdfbookmark["Page"] = "0 /XYZ";

instead of

pdfbookmark["Page"] = "/XYZ";

Having the first one meant that SimpleBookmark rejected the
destination. I think.
Perhaps SimpleBookmark could be made a little more verbose, I don't
think it raised any errors.
